Overview
The Littelfuse K2400GH is a high-voltage trigger diode (SIDAC) designed for overvoltage protection in through-hole applications. It operates within the Kxxxzy series and utilizes a DO-15 package. The device features a breakover voltage (VBO) range of 220 V to 250 V with a maximum breakover current (IBO) of 10 uA. It supports a rated repetitive off-state voltage (VDRM) of 190 V and maintains a low leakage current of 5 uA at VDRM. The component handles an RMS on-state current (It RMS) of 1 A and non-repetitive peak currents of 16.7 A or 20 A. It exhibits an on-state voltage of 1.5 V, a maximum holding current (Ih) of 150 mA, and functions reliably between -40 C and +85 C.

Part Context
The K2400GH belongs to Littelfuse's K-series SIDAC family, which specializes in high-voltage trigger diodes. These components are distinct from standard TVS diodes by their ability to handle higher energy pulses and their latching behavior until current drops below the holding threshold. This series is widely used in industrial and communication infrastructure for reliable transient suppression.
